1. Analysis
1.1 Compromise Type Identification
| Type |
Indicators |
Detection |
| Spyware/Stalkerware |
Rogue MDM profiles, unknown device admin apps, battery drain |
MDM, MTD |
| Jailbreak/Root |
Cydia, Magisk, SuperSU, integrity check failures |
MDM jailbreak detection |
| Malicious App |
Sideloaded APK/IPA, unknown app with permissions |
MTD, MDM app inventory |
| SIM Swap |
Loss of cellular signal, MFA codes not received |
User report, carrier |
| Smishing/Phishing |
Suspicious SMS link clicked, credential entered |
User report, MTD |
| Network attack |
Rogue Wi-Fi, man-in-the-middle on public network |
MTD, certificate errors |

2.2 SIM Swap Specific
| # |
Action |
Done |
| 1 |
Contact carrier immediately to restore number and lock SIM |
☐ |
| 2 |
Change MFA from SMS to authenticator app / FIDO2 |
☐ |
| 3 |
Reset passwords for ALL accounts using SMS MFA |
☐ |
| 4 |
Check for unauthorized access during SIM swap window |
☐ |
| 5 |
File report with carrier and law enforcement |
☐ |

6. Escalation Criteria
| Condition |
Escalate To |
| Executive device compromised |
CISO immediately |
| SIM swap targeting admin / VIP |
CISO + Identity team |
| Corporate data exfiltrated from device |
Legal + DPO (PDPA 72h) |
| Spyware with remote access capability |
Tier 2 + External forensics |
| Multiple devices compromised (campaign) |
Major Incident |
| Jailbroken device accessed sensitive systems |
SOC Lead + IT |
